Time For the United Nations to Define Terrorism

A dozen explosions ripped through the Iraqi capital in rapid succession Wednesday, killing at least 152 people and wounding 542 in a series of attacks that began with a suicide car bombing that targeted laborers assembled to find work for the day.

Today the President addressed the United Nations. Meanwhile the United Nations still can't come together and define the word "Terrorism".

Today the President stated,As a symbol of our commitment to human dignity, the United States will return to UNESCO. (Applause.)
This organization has been reformed and America will participate fully in its mission to advance human rights and tolerance and learning.
Confronting our enemies is essential, and so civilized nations will continue to take the fight to the terrorists. Yet we know that this war will not be won by force of arms alone. We must defeat the terrorists on the battlefield, and we must also defeat them in the battle of ideas. We must change the conditions that allow terrorists to flourish and recruit, by spreading the hope of freedom to millions who've never known it. We must help raise up the failing states and stagnant societies that provide fertile ground for the terrorists. We must defend and extend a vision of human dignity, and opportunity, and prosperity -- a vision far stronger than the dark appeal of resentment and murder.
No applause
It's really time for the UN to define terrorism.
